Understanding the Mind–Body Connection

The mind and body are not separate systems. They are part of one continuous feedback loop.

Your brain regulates movement, breathing, posture, and effort.
Your body sends constant signals back to your brain about safety, fatigue, and stress.

When movement is inconsistent or excessive, the nervous system stays in a heightened state. That state reduces focus, shortens attention span, and increases mental noise. When movement is intentional and well paced, the nervous system shifts toward regulation, which supports clearer thinking and emotional stability.

How Fitness Coaching Supports Mental Clarity

Most people approach exercise with aesthetics or performance in mind. While those outcomes can matter, mental clarity depends on how you train, not just what you do.

A well designed coaching plan supports mental clarity in several ways.

Reducing Mental Noise

Unstructured training often increases stress. Random workouts, excessive intensity, and skipped recovery keep the nervous system overstimulated. That overstimulation shows up as racing thoughts and difficulty concentrating.

Fitness coaching introduces structure and pacing. Sessions are designed to challenge the body without overwhelming it. As physical stress becomes predictable and manageable, mental noise decreases.

Improving Executive Function

Executive function includes focus, planning, emotional control, and decision making. These skills improve when blood flow to the brain is consistent and stress hormones are regulated.

Balanced fitness programs that include aerobic work, strength training, and recovery support these neurological processes. Over time, clients report clearer thinking, faster decisions, and improved follow through.

Stabilizing Mood and Energy

Mental clarity depends on emotional stability. When energy crashes throughout the day, focus suffers.

Fitness coaching helps regulate energy by aligning training intensity with recovery capacity. This prevents the highs and lows that come from overtraining or inactivity, creating steadier motivation and mood.

A Practical Fitness Framework for Mental Clarity

Mental clarity does not require extreme routines. It requires balance.

The following framework is effective nationwide and adaptable to different environments and schedules.

Aerobic Base Training

Two to three sessions per week at a conversational pace.

This type of training supports cerebral blood flow and helps regulate the stress response. Walking, cycling, light jogging, or incline treadmill work are all effective.

Strength Training

Two to three sessions per week focusing on compound movements.

Squats, hinges, presses, pulls, carries, and controlled core work improve posture and physical resilience. Reducing physical discomfort reduces cognitive distraction.

Mindful Mobility and Breathwork

Short daily sessions focused on breathing and joint mobility.

Breath control helps downshift the nervous system. Mobility restores ease of movement, which directly impacts mental ease.

Recovery Practices

Recovery is not optional. Sleep routines, hydration, light movement on rest days, and consistent schedules support mental clarity as much as training itself.

Fitness coaching ensures recovery is treated as a skill, not an afterthought.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the connection between fitness and mental clarity

Movement increases blood flow to the brain, supports neurotransmitter balance, and regulates the stress response. Fitness coaching ensures these benefits occur without overstimulation or burnout.

Can fitness coaching help with focus and stress management

Yes. Structured training combined with recovery and breathwork helps reduce mental chatter and improves emotional resilience.

Do I need a gym or special equipment

No. Effective programs can be built using bodyweight movements, basic weights, or outdoor training. Coaching adapts to what you have available.

How long does it take to notice mental clarity improvements

Many people notice changes in focus and mood within a few weeks of consistent, well paced training. Long term clarity builds with continued practice.

How is coaching different from workout apps

Apps provide exercises. Coaching provides pacing, context, recovery guidance, and feedback. These elements are essential for mental clarity and sustainable results.
